It turned out very cute!Excellent job!<br />It turned out very cute!That Crazy Ajummahttps://www.blogger.com/profile/15874359006831711711noreply@blogger.comtag:blogger.com,1999:blog-8067345738741699448.post-88212529920725294312011-05-23T17:15:29.868-05:002011-05-23T17:15:29.868-05:00How do you form a princess seam from an already se...How do you form a princess seam from an already sewn blouse? Do you cut the fabric first into 2 pieces? I'm unfamiliar with this.Thorinanoreply@blogger.comtag:blogger.com,1999:blog-8067345738741699448.post-27542020920852949462011-05-23T13:51:35.786-05:002011-05-23T13:51:35.786-05:00Oh Sherry, I love the results!
